Существует ли общее «эмпирическое правило» для максимального процента памяти, которую должна использовать задача обработPython

Программы на Python
Ответить
Anonymous
 Существует ли общее «эмпирическое правило» для максимального процента памяти, которую должна использовать задача обработ

Сообщение Anonymous »

В настоящее время я помогаю в проекте, связанном с большими наборами климатических данных. Один из наших этапов обработки включает в себя чтение файлов netCDF по частям, чтобы предотвратить использование слишком большого количества оперативной памяти. Чем больше размер фрагмента, тем быстрее выполняется этап обработки.
Идея состоит в том, чтобы создать сценарий, который можно запустить с использованием скромных ресурсов (16 ГБ ОЗУ, 4-ядерный процессор, персональный компьютер/ноутбук). ) в разумные сроки.
Мой руководитель считает, что нам не следует использовать более 30 % доступной памяти, и хочет ограничить размер фрагмента, чтобы учесть это. Я немного погуглил, но кроме ответа ИИ Google (ссылки на источники которого, похоже, не содержат этой информации), я не могу найти ничего о максимальном объеме памяти или этом правиле 30%. Есть ли у кого-нибудь какие-либо идеи о том, каким будет разумный предел, или есть ресурсы, где можно узнать об этом больше?

Подробнее здесь: https://stackoverflow.com/questions/793 ... y-a-data-p
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Python»